MEDNAX Inc (MD) is a leading provider of physician services, including newborn, maternal-fetal, pediatric subspecialty and anesthesia care. Within the context of MEDNAX Inc (MD), one important financial metric to consider is EBIT (earnings before interest and taxes) and EBITDA (earnings before interest, taxes, depreciation, and amortization). EBIT measures the company's operating profitability before considering the impact of interest and taxes. It provides insight into the company's core operations. Similarly, EBITDA is a useful metric as it eliminates the effects of non-operating items such as depreciation and amortization. It helps assess the company's underlying operating performance.
Lastly, free cash flow is an important indicator of MEDNAX Inc's financial health. It represents the cash generated by the company after deducting capital expenditures or investments in property, plant, and equipment. Positive free cash flow indicates the company's ability to fund its operations, invest in growth opportunities, and return value to shareholders.
